WebAcceleration is a vector quantity, with both magnitude and direction. Acceleration is the rate of change of an object's velocity. The SI unit of acceleration is meters per second squared (sometimes written as "per second per second"), m/s 2. Imagine that at a time t 1 an object is moving at a velocity with magnitude v 1. The city had two parts, one magnitude and the … WebDisplacement is the change in position of an object. In symbols, displacement Δ x is defined to be. Δ x = xf − xo, where xo is the initial position and xf is the final position. In this text, the Greek letter Δ (delta) always means “change in” whatever quantity follows it. A point or an object moving in a straight line is accelerated if it speeds up or slows down. Motion on a circle is accelerated even if the speed is constant, because the direction is continually changing. For all other kinds of motion, both effects contribute to the …
